This was my sixth session with Taslima. For this lesson we worked on regular and irregular verbs. First, we covered regular verbs. I asked Taslima to make simple sentences using 10 verbs. I corrected any errors she made in her sentences (these were written sentences). Afterwards, we covered irregular verbs. I found a chart online and told her she would simply `have to memorize these because there were no tricks to learn them, really. We again made sentences with 10 irregular common verbs. I reviewed all the errors with her.
For the remaining portion of the session, we did some roleplaying. This was for speaking practice. We did a role-play where Taslima had to decline an invitation and explain why she could not go. I corrected her errors as we went along. The second was how she would order food at a restaurant and explain to them about the stuff she cannot eat. The third play was how she would make an appointment at the doctors. (This took longer than expected, as Taslima took quite some time brainstorming).
Taslima’s kids are very young but they seem to enjoy taking part in our sessions. They do not understand much of what I say but sometimes they will repeat words that I repeat when correcting Taslima’s mistakes. Surprisingly, the older son is catching onto English pretty good by watching a lot of Youtube videos. I encouraged Taslima to watch more English videos whether it be cooking, educational, or entertainment. We had a discussion about how listening will help her learn more about the speech patterns in the English language.
